Output 0d629744744fc5be600c8ca853ac375644e613458dd1947c516c6e27dc2a2518:2

value
1491066268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fa5cd5e73510b6cf66b73449b92802cff816fa7 OP_EQUAL
address
3GF9zBhA9X76LxC23Bg75msuAZc8nRX7DS
transaction
0d629744744fc5be600c8ca853ac375644e613458dd1947c516c6e27dc2a2518
confirmations
487568
spent
true